the length of a side of the square is 4x-1. write a simplified expression that represents the perimeter of the square
Temka [501]
Answer: 16x - 4

Explanation: Since all of the sides of a square are equal in length by definition, the perimeter of a square is 4 times its side length. 4(4x-1) is 16x - 4 when simplified.
